Power Of Attorney By Ethiopian Embassy Consular.


The Power of Attorney provided by Embassy of Ethiopia is in English or Amharic language. The agent must take the power of attorney to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Ethiopia for authentication and to the documents authentication and registration office for registration before presenting it to the concerned body.
The process of Power of Attorney is different for foreigners and the Ethiopians. If you wish to apply with Ethiopian Embassy Consular then process as follow:

 FOR ETHIOPIAN WHO ARE A HOLDERS OF AN ETHIOPIAN ORIGIN ID CARD 
  • Request for registration form for Power of Attorney.
  •  Power of attorney statement detailing the specific authorities, the applicant wishes to delegate to the agent  and signed in front of the relevant or to be signed in front of the consular head at the Embassy.
  • Certified copy of the driving license and either certified copy of valid Ethiopian passport or Ethiopian origin ID card.
  • A prepaid, self-addressed, trackable and registered envelope for the return of the Document. Keep the tracking number and track online to follow up on your application.
  • Pay service fees in cash at the Embassy of Ethiopia, or by Australian Post Money Order or International Bank Cheque (Australia Post Money Orders and Bank Cheques must be payable to the “Ethiopian Embassy”).


 FOR FOREIGNERS
  • Request for registration form for Power of Attorney.
  •  Power of attorney statement detailing the specific authorities, the applicant wishes to delegate to the agent and signed in front of the relevant organization or to be signed in front of the consular head at the Embassy.
  • Certified copy of a valid Passport and driving license.
  • A prepaid, self-addressed, trackable and registered envelope for the return of the Document. please keep the tracking number and track online to follow up your application.
  • Pay service fees in cash at the Embassy of Ethiopia, or by Australian Post  Money Order or International Bank Cheque (Australia Post Money Orders and Bank Cheques must be payable to the “Ethiopian Embassy”)
For the ease of this process now the Embassy of Ethiopia provides Digital power of An attorney with the use of E-POA iOS and android app.
